WEDNESDAY, JANUARY 10
Scripture: Matthew 5:38-39, James 4:5-7

In Matthew 5:38-39 Jesus taught, ‘Do not resist’ (anth-his-tay-mee). This means to reach up and lay hands on the opposition and jerk it out of position, so that one can achieve a purpose. In this verse, Jesus taught not to do that but the context in which He taught that is important. Understanding this will help us better grasp what has been forfeited. In Matthew 4:5-7, we have a perfect picture of what satan has done to the church. In this passage the devil took Jesus to Jerusalem and set Him on the pinnacle of the temple and then preached Him a message out of Psalm 91. The Lord told me He was going to reinterpret that for me and He said, ‘satan took Jesus to church and preached Him a message.’ And then He said, ‘That’s exactly what has happened in your generation. Satan took us to church and preached us a message and neutered the church into passivity! He did it with Matthew 5:38-39.’ Basically the Lord was saying, the church has been overwhelmed with passivity by turning the other cheek and not resisting evil. We have the fruit of it today. All seven mountains are in much worse shape today than they were 43 years ago. It is both sad and true but it does not have to continue. It can stop when we set the record straight and put Matthew 5:38-39 in context.
